Mosque-Madrassa of Sultan Hassan: The Monumental Masterpiece of Mamluk CairoExperience the Mosque-Madrassa of Sultan Hassan, an awe-inspiring architectural triumph and one of the most massive and magnificent mosques in the Islamic world. Built in the 14th century during the Mamluk era, this colossal stone complex stands dramatically near the Cairo Citadel, offering a breathtaking, monumental journey into Egypt's golden age of Islamic architecture.We’ll guide you through the soaring, dark entrance portal, where the absolute must-see feature emerges as you step into the spectacular open-air central courtyard (sahn). Here, a beautifully ornate, domed ablution fountain is surrounded by four gigantic vaulted halls (iwans), each historically dedicated to teaching one of the four main schools of Sunni Islamic law. For a fascinating hidden gem, step into the quiet main sanctuary behind the eastern iwan to marvel at the solemn mausoleum of the Sultan, the intricate marble mihrab, and the mesmerizing cascade of hanging glass lamps. From the breathtaking, intricate muqarnas (stalactite carvings) to the sheer, towering scale of the ancient stone walls, the mosque is a profound triumph of medieval engineering.The Mosque-Madrassa of Sultan Hassan is central to any deep architectural exploration of historic Cairo. We strongly suggest combining your visit with the magnificent Al-Rifai Mosque located directly next door, and visiting in the mid-morning when the sunlight beams dramatically down into the central courtyard, creating perfect, high-contrast architectural photography conditions. Remember to dress modestly and be prepared to remove your shoes before entering the carpeted spaces.
